如何使用Access创建高效进销存管理系统?

2024-10-01 发布
如何使用Access创建高效进销存管理系统?

在当今快速发展的商业环境中,高效的进销存管理对于企业的运营至关重要。它不仅帮助公司更好地控制库存水平,还能够提升客户满意度和财务绩效。Access,作为Microsoft Office套件中的重要工具之一,提供了一个强大的数据库解决方案,可以帮助企业轻松实现进销存管理自动化。本文将详细介绍如何使用Access来创建高效且功能丰富的进销存管理系统。

一、准备工作

在开始使用Access创建进销存管理系统之前,你需要先确定一些关键信息,如公司的业务流程、需要跟踪的数据类型等。这些准备工作将直接影响到系统的设计与实现。

首先,你需要了解企业的业务流程。这包括进货、销售、退货以及库存盘点等环节。这些流程决定了你所需要的功能模块。

其次,明确需要收集和管理的数据类型。例如,商品信息(名称、型号、规格等)、供应商信息(名称、联系人、地址等)、客户信息(姓名、联系方式等)以及交易记录(日期、数量、价格等)。了解这些信息后,就可以开始设计数据库表结构。

二、设计数据库结构

Access中,数据库由多个表格组成,每个表格代表一类实体。因此,在开始创建数据库之前,需要设计合理的表结构。

1. 创建基础表格

基础表格通常包括商品表、供应商表、客户表、员工表以及仓库位置表等。这些表格用于存储与各个实体相关的基本信息。

例如:

  • 商品表:包括商品编号、名称、型号、规格、单位、单价、库存量等字段;
  • 供应商表:包括供应商编号、名称、联系人、电话、邮箱、地址等字段;
  • 客户表:包括客户编号、姓名、联系方式、地址等字段;
  • 员工表:包括员工编号、姓名、职位、联系方式等字段;
  • 仓库位置表:包括仓库编号、名称、位置描述等字段。

2. 设计关联表格

为了确保数据的一致性和完整性,需要设计关联表格。这些表格主要用于存储不同实体之间的关系,例如进货记录表、销售记录表以及退货记录表等。

例如:

  • 进货记录表:包括记录编号、商品编号、供应商编号、采购数量、采购日期、采购员等字段;
  • 销售记录表:包括记录编号、商品编号、客户编号、销售数量、销售日期、销售人员等字段;
  • 退货记录表:包括记录编号、商品编号、客户编号、退货数量、退货日期等字段。

3. 设置主键与外键

为了保证数据的唯一性和完整性,需要为主表设置主键,并在外表中通过外键引用主表的主键。这样可以避免数据冗余并确保数据一致性。

三、构建用户界面

尽管Access强大的数据处理能力使其成为进销存管理的理想选择,但如果没有友好的用户界面,操作起来可能会非常复杂。因此,我们需要为用户提供简洁易用的操作界面。

1. 表单设计

表单是用户与数据库交互的主要途径。你可以根据实际需求设计各种表单,如商品添加表单、销售订单表单、退货申请表单等。这些表单应包含必要的输入控件,如文本框、下拉列表、复选框等。

2. 查询设计

查询功能可以帮助用户快速查找所需信息。利用Access提供的查询向导或SQL语句,可以创建各种类型的查询,如按条件筛选、分组汇总、多表联查等。

3. 报告生成

报告是进销存管理系统的重要组成部分。通过设计自定义报表,用户可以查看详细的销售情况、库存状态、财务状况等信息。利用Access内置的报表设计工具,可以轻松创建美观实用的报表模板。

4. 宏与VBA编程

为了进一步提高系统的灵活性和自动化程度,你可以使用宏或编写VBA代码来实现更复杂的功能。例如,可以编写宏或VBA脚本来自动更新库存余额、计算利润、发送邮件通知等。

四、系统测试与优化

完成初步开发后,必须对整个系统进行全面测试,以确保其正常运行并满足所有业务需求。测试过程中可能会发现一些问题或不足之处,这时就需要进行相应的调整和优化。

1. 功能测试

功能测试主要是验证各个功能模块是否按照预期工作。这包括数据录入、修改、删除、查询等功能。测试时应注意检查数据的一致性、准确性和完整性。

2. 性能测试

性能测试则侧重于评估系统的响应速度、稳定性和负载承受能力。由于Access数据库文件的大小和记录数量可能会影响系统的性能表现,因此需要特别关注这一点。

3. 安全测试

安全测试主要是确保系统的安全性。这包括密码保护、权限管理、数据备份等方面。确保只有授权人员才能访问敏感信息,并定期备份数据库以防数据丢失。

4. 用户反馈

最后,通过向用户征求反馈意见,可以帮助你发现潜在的问题或改进空间。用户的意见和建议对于持续优化系统非常重要。

五、部署与维护

经过充分测试和优化后,进销存管理系统就可以正式投入使用了。但在系统上线之后,还需要做好后续的维护工作,以确保系统的长期稳定运行。

1. 系统培训

在系统正式使用前,对相关人员进行培训是非常重要的一步。这有助于他们熟悉系统的操作流程,并正确使用系统。

2. 数据备份

定期备份数据库文件是一项必不可少的工作。这样可以在意外发生时及时恢复数据,避免造成重大损失。

3. 系统升级

随着业务的发展和技术的进步,进销存管理系统也需要不断更新和完善。定期检查是否有新的版本可用,并考虑是否有必要进行升级。

4. 用户支持

提供良好的技术支持服务,可以帮助解决用户在使用过程中遇到的各种问题。设立专门的技术支持团队或热线电话,以便用户随时咨询。